Volvo Trucks in Ely is seeking a skilled HGV Technician to perform service, maintenance, and repairs on Volvo vehicles. The ideal candidate holds a Level 3 qualification and has experience with HGVs, demonstrating strong diagnostic skills.

This role includes a competitive salary of up to £21 per hour and a signing bonus, alongside opportunities for professional development and a comprehensive benefits package, including a generous pension plan and health cash plan.
